I watched this before deciding to try the MiniFit. After rebuilding it for the first time, it just wasn't producing nearly the amount of vapor, as the original pod. I tried 30 Kanthal & 32 Kanthal but there was no difference. Very skimpy vapor production. I did some searching and found a discussion about rebuilding the MiniFit. (I wish I could remember where I saw the discussion). Others had the same issue with very little vapor production after a rebuild. As I kept reading I came across a link for pre-coiled NR-R-NR coils. That was the answer.

The MiniFit is a 3.4 V constant voltage device. What was happening was the legs of a standard Kanthal coil were heating up, and causing enough of a voltage drop, that the coil wasn't getting enough voltage to vaporize the eliquid properly.

$1.72 Pre-Coiled Welded Wires - NR-R-NR (50-Pack) 50-pack - 33 AWG / 1.8ohm / 30*30mm at FastTech - Free Shipping

Once I tried the NR-R-NR coils, the problem was solved. The MiniFit produced vapor as well as the original pod. Its also amazing (to me) how long the coils last. A convenience store owner on the reservation where Foxwoods Casino is refused to collect & pay Connecticut state cigarette taxes a few years ago. He said -- rightly, as far as the law goes -- that he wasn't a resident of Connecticut but of a distinct nation and his store wasn't located in the state but in the sovereign territory of that nation. People were going there to stock up on cigarettes.
The state proceeded to place state cops on the roads going into the reservation to turn away anyone entering. The store owner backed down.
When it comes to their tax revenue, states will spare no effort. Road repairs, crime, etc., not so much, but taxes -- don't mess with them.
